While he has been a force on the line, senior defensive end Chauncey Rivers must take things up a notch after Mississippi State’s bye week, as the Bulldogs will be heading to Knoxville, Tennessee next week.
Though the Volunteers are not the Bulldogs’ toughest test, Mississippi State must take advantage of this bye to get back on track. While Rivers’ leadership and experience is widely apparent, his numbers are in need of a spike. With 15 total tackles, 10 solo, a sack, and a pass broken up, expect Rivers to have a bigger impact against Tennessee and beyond.

As defensive line play is an integral component to success in today’s Southeastern Conference, look for Rivers to take control and become more comfortable in his role. Set to face quarterbacks by the likes of Joe Burrow and Tua Tagovailoa, Rivers will be heavily relied upon to set the defensive tone.
Rivers should make the necessary adjustments throughout the bye week. Coming off a disappointing loss to Auburn, Mississippi State is sure to take out its frustration on Tennessee, with Rivers at the forefront. Expect him to have his way.
